Technical Specifications
Frame: Alloy 700C17"
Fork: Suspension fork travel= 65 mm with lockout
Handlebar: Alloy Width660MM. 30mm rise
Stem: Alloy 70mm +-7
Grip: L:125mm,R:92mm, Closed end
Crankset: 170mm Crank, 36t Chainring
Pedal: 9/16" Alloy
Chain: 1/2"*3/32"*108L
Freewheel: Shimano CS-HG200-8,8-SPEED, 12-14-16-18-21-24-28-32(BR
Derailleur R: Shimano Tourney TY300D
Shifter: Shimano SL-M315-8R, RIGHT, 8-SPEED RAPIDFIRE PLUS
Brake: Front / Rear Mechanical disc brake w/ 160mm rotor
Hub Front: 3/8"*13G*36H
Rim: 26"*1.5*13G*36H, H= 25 A/V
Spokes: 249mm W/14mm Steel nipple
Tire: 700*40C
Seat Post: ?27.2*350mm
Seat Clamp: ?31.8 Quick Release
Kickstand: Steel Kickstand

Electrical Components
Motor: 700C 36V250W 25KM/H - Complies to EN15194
Torque Sensor: Dual hall Cable:80MM
Display: 0-5 level, Max Speed 25kph
Controller: square wave 36V*12A
Battery: 36v, 8.7AH Samsung battery cell
Charger: 42V 2A DC2.1 charger port

Electric Bike Battery Information
The travel distance after a full charge on this e-Bike can vary from 30km to 70km.
There are several factors that will affect how long the battery will last after a full charge.

Factors include:
Level of pedal assistance higher level of assistance will use more battery charge
Weight of Rider & Luggage more weight may require more power from the battery
Terrain & Weather Conditions Terrain & wind may cause drag, and will require more power to maintain speed.
Tyre Conditions Incorrect tyre pressure may create more rolling resistance
Traffic/Route Conditions Stop/Start cycling may use more power to accelerate up to appropriate travelling speeds.
